A £24,000 scheme has been launched to provide help to local businesses in Carlisle during the Covid-19 global pandemic. The Buy Local Carlisle project uses government funding allocated to Carlisle City Council through the Reopening High Streets Safety European Regional Development Fund (ERDF). Working with local businesswoman, Michelle Masters to deliver the scheme, it will continue the ongoing free support made available through the established Small Business Support Group Carlisle on Facebook. Set up by Michelle in May last year, the Facebook group already has over 3,700 members and promotes business to business support. The funding will also be used to provide business mentoring support and the development of a local business directory.
